"The Long Con" - Survivors fear that "The Others"
may have returned when Sun is injured during a failed kidnapping attempt.
Meanwhile, Sawyer is an amused but highly interested bystander when
tension escalates between Jack, Locke, Kate and Ana Lucia, on
"Lost," WEDNESDAY, FEBRUARY 8 (9:00-10:03 p.m., ET), on the ABC
Television Network.
"Lost" stars Adewale Akinnuoye-Agbaje as Mr. Eko, Naveen
Andrews as Sayid, Emilie de Ravin as Claire, Matthew Fox as Jack, Jorge
Garcia as Hurley, Josh Holloway as Sawyer, Daniel Dae Kim as Jin, Yunjin
Kim as Sun, Evangeline Lilly as Kate, Dominic Monaghan as Charlie, Terry
O'Quinn as Locke, Harold Perrineau as Michael, Michelle Rodriguez as Ana
Lucia and Cynthia Watros as Libby.
Guest starring are Kevin Dunn as Gordy, Beth Broderick as Diane, KM
Dickens as Cassidy, Finn Armstrong as Arthur and Richard Cavanna as Peter.
"The Long Con" was written by Leonard Dick & Steven Maeda
and directed by Roxann Dawson.
